Israel Aircraft Industries IAI 1125A Astra SPX (SPX)

Overview

N718NP assigned/registered to BLACKHAWK EQUIPMENT LEASING LLC; IAI 1125A Astra SPX MSN 135; recent N-number activity in 2025 following earlier U.S. registration activity under N718NB / N809JW. Certificate/airworthiness entries associated with the airframe date to 2023 for the current U.S. registry actions.

Specifications

  • Engines: 2× Honeywell TFE731-40R (4462 lbf each)
  • Range: 2517 nm
  • Cruise: 470 kts
  • Seats: 14
  • Ceiling: 45000 ft

Operations & Cabin

Typical executive 6–8 passenger layout reported on completions; FAA certificated seating up to 14. Executive club seating, forward galley, aft lavatory often fitted; specific fit varies by completion (previous broker listing described a 7‑passenger interior). Avionics: Rockwell Collins Pro Line 5 (reported on earlier listing for MSN 135)

Model & Market Context

This airframe, N718NP, is an Israel Aircraft Industries-built IAI 1125A Astra SPX with manufacturer's serial number 135 and a model year of 2001. The jet is recorded as owned by BLACKHAWK EQUIPMENT LEASING LLC, a corporation based in Jacksonville, FL, and is U.S. registered. Registry records and listings have noted the airframe's market valuation at $2,000,000, reflecting its age and equipment fit for leasing or charter use. Documentation indicates the airframe is configured and certificated for U.S. operations under its current corporate ownership.

The cabin of this specific airframe is reported to have a typical executive layout for 6–8 passengers as completed, while the FAA certificated seating allows up to 14 occupants, enabling flexible use between corporate transport and higher-density special missions. Earlier listings for manufacturer serial number 135 report a Rockwell Collins Pro Line 5 avionics suite installed, supporting modern navigation and communications capability for regional and transcontinental flight profiles. Operated from a base in Jacksonville, FL under corporate ownership, the aircraft is suited to charter and leasing operations that require transcontinental range and high cruise speed. Maintenance planning for the airframe would follow IAI/Type-specific schedules for the twin Honeywell TFE731-40R engines and airframe systems consistent with light business jet norms.

The IAI 1125A Astra SPX occupies a performance niche as a long-range light-to-midsize business jet, offering high cruise speed and a 45,000 ft service ceiling that appeal to operators needing fast point-to-point capability. Competing models in the same market segment typically include late-model light midsize jets with similar range and speed; valuation of $2,000,000 for a 2001 airframe reflects age, avionics fitment, and market demand for refurbished or leased examples. Buyers and lessees consider total cost of ownership, engine hours on Honeywell TFE731-40R powerplants, and completion standards when assessing resale and operational viability.
